2:30 pm, Science 2-065 Steven JacksonUniversity of Massachusetts BostonPrehomogeneous Spaces Associated With Real Nilpotent Orbits
Abstract:
Let g_0 be a real semisimple Lie algebra. Each conjugacy
class of nilpotent elements in g_0 gives rise via the
Kostant-Sekiguchi correspondence to a Z-grading on the
associated symmetric pair (g,k), with respect to which
each homogeneous component is a prehomogeneous vector space under
the natural action of K_0. In this talk, we discuss methods
for the determination of the isomorphism types and relative invariants
of these prehomogeneous spaces from combinatorial data attached to
the nilpotent orbit. This is joint work with Alfred Noël.
